STATE OF LOUISIANA COURT OF APPEAL, FIRST CIRCUIT STATE OF LOUISIANA NO. 2021 KW 0711 VERSUS
PETER CELESTINE OCTOBER 5, 2021
In Re: Peter Celestine, applying for supervisory writs, 19th Judicial District Court, Parish of East Baton Rouge, No. DC - 19- 06524.
BEFORE: WHIPPLE, C. J., PENZATO AND HESTER, JJ.
WRIT DENIED ON THE SHOWING MADE. Relator failed to include the district court' s ruling denying the motion for speedy trial.
Instead, relator included the proposed order that accompanied the motion for speedy trial, on which the October 12, 2021 trial date appears; however, the proposed order does not include the judge' s signature. Relator also failed to include the bill of information, pertinent district court minutes, and other any portion of the district court record that would support the claim raised in the writ application.
